How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Rock Island Moline?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Outer Rock Island Moline Studio Apartments | $973 | $698 | $1,250 |
| Outer Rock Island Moline 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,035 | $750 | $1,700 |
| Outer Rock Island Moline 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,235 | $591 | $3,250 |
| Outer Rock Island Moline 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,650 | $1,250 | $2,345 |
| Outer Rock Island Moline 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,508 | $2,025 | $2,695 |
